Warner Bros Hit A Box Office Record In 2018

Image
Warner Bros is the real star that rose in 2018. Disney seems to own just about everything at this point, so it's no surprise when one of its brands tops the box office. But Warner Bros deserves a hat tip for still managing to set a new box office record during the same year as Black Panther, Avengers: Infinity War, and Incredibles 2. Warner Bros's worldwide box office passed $5.6 billion in ticket sales, Variety reports, that was its biggest year to date, and up 9% from 2017. Much of the credit for that is being given to Aquaman -- DCEU's top movie worldwide, and it's still going strong into 2019 -- but also The Meg, Fantastic Beasts: The Crimes of Grindelwald, and Ready Player One. More on their respective contributions in a minute. That worldwide total is from a combination of roughly $1.95 billion domestic and $3.6 billion foreign. Aquaman Officialy Become The Biggest DC Extended Universe Movie

Image
Aquaman, the much-mocked underdog superhero, long dissed as the one who merely “talks to fish,” leads the highest-grossing DC Extended Universe movie at the global box office. Aquaman has just passed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ice in worldwide ticket sales. As of Saturday, the Warner Bros. release has grossed $887 million since its release last month, edging out Batman v Superman‘s cumulative $873 million. The King of Atlantis has been helped enormously by overseas interest, with international sales responsible for 75 percent of the films revenue — a significantly greater percentage than the other DCEU titles (China leads the way, where Aquaman has grossed a whopping $279 million to become the country’s second-biggest superhero film of all time behind Avengers: Infinity War. Aquaman Past Wonder Woman ?

Image
Aquaman has officially passed Wonder Woman at the box office. In less than a month, the DC universe has truly found its savior. Arthur Curry had won the hearts of fans as the King of Atlantis, but the character hadn't truly had the chance to shine in a proper way until now. And audiences are really taking to it, as Aquaman continues to rake in the cash all over the world. With the New Year's Day box office factored in, Aquaman has now grossed $216.3 million domestically and $606.5 million overseas, bringing its worldwide total of $822.9 million. That puts it just ahead of Wonder Woman, which managed to bring in $821.8 million last year. However, director Patty Jenkins' Wonder Woman made quite a bit more domestically, as the movie grossed $412.6 million here in the states. The fact that, Aquaman is still the lowest grossing movie in the current DC franchise domestically, still sitting behind Justice League ($229 million). Annabelle 3 Will Feels Like A New Conjuring Film

Image
What started with The Conjuring in 2013 has grown organically into a connected universe with spinoffs of the mainline films that are now spawning sequels of their own. While we'll probably have to wait until 2020 for The Conjuring 3, the next sequel in The Conjuring universe arrives this year in the form of Annabelle 3. Unlike the other spinoffs to date in this universe, Annabelle 3 will actually feel like a new Conjuring film according to producer James Wan, who said: "I think by the very nature of Patrick and Vera being in it, I would say somewhat, yes, because in Annabelle 3 the doll comes back to the Warren's home. It finally comes to the Warren's home so by the very nature of it actually being in the home and the story takes place in the Warren's home, it feels more like a Conjuring film in that respect".
